Output 99f97a0e81ab6185ab522c2d78032152efb9d699a61ae396317d039eae4dfa00:160

value
23068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8a1d6a0ac34e5bd3155ff7a80411c6d0c55614 OP_EQUAL
address
3DE6X76FuqLKESDADKm16W9bvaz63buaGC
transaction
99f97a0e81ab6185ab522c2d78032152efb9d699a61ae396317d039eae4dfa00
spent
true